news 2026/4/30 21:06:30

九毛钱的RDA5807FP芯片,如何让我焊出了一台复古机械按键FM收音机?

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
九毛钱的RDA5807FP芯片,如何让我焊出了一台复古机械按键FM收音机?

九毛钱的RDA5807FP芯片,如何让我焊出了一台复古机械按键FM收音机?

去年整理旧物时翻出一台90年代的德生收音机,转动调频旋钮的"咔嗒"声瞬间勾起童年回忆。这种触觉反馈在触屏时代已成奢侈品,于是我萌生了个疯狂想法:用不到十元的芯片+机械按键,复刻这种物理交互的仪式感。

1. 芯片选型:为什么是RDA5807FP?

在淘宝搜索"收音机芯片"时,RDA5807FP的价格标签让我怀疑是否看错了小数点——0.9元/片还包邮。这款2010年面世的国产FM接收芯片,其性价比颠覆了我对射频器件的认知:

核心参数对比表

特性RDA5807FPTEA5767(经典进口芯片)
供电电压1.8-3.6V2.7-5V
信噪比50dB60dB
封装形式SSOP-16SSOP-24
市场价格¥0.9¥12

实际测试中发现三个惊喜:

  1. 直接支持32Ω耳机驱动,省去功放电路
  2. I2C接口可扩展单片机控制(本项目未使用)
  3. 接收灵敏度达到-98dBm,在室内无需外接天线

注意:芯片批次不同可能导致引脚定义微调,务必核对卖家提供的规格书

2. 机械按键的"奢侈"选择

为还原老式收音机的物理触感,我放弃了常规的贴片按键,转而选用樱桃MX轴机械开关。这个决定让BOM成本暴增10倍:

# 成本结构分析 components = { "RDA5807FP芯片": 0.9, "PCB打板(5片)": 2.0, "机械按键x4": 15.8, # 樱桃MX红轴 "金属键帽x4": 32.0, # 定制雕刻频段符号 "其他元件": 3.5 } total_cost = sum(components.values()) # 54.2元

键帽定制过程更有意思:

  • 用Fusion360设计立体频段符号
  • 找本地激光雕刻作坊加工
  • 表面做旧处理模仿 vintage 风格

焊接时发现机械开关的引脚间距与PCB不匹配,临时飞线的解决方案:

  1. 用1mm钻头扩大过孔
  2. 镀锡铜线绕轴体一周固定
  3. 点胶防止应力断裂

3. 无单片机方案的精简设计

为保持纯粹模拟设备的质感,我放弃了常见的Arduino控制方案,采用最简电路:

+---------------+ | 3V纽扣电池 | +-------+-------+ | +-------+-------+ | LC滤波网络 | +-------+-------+ | +-------+-------+ | RDA5807FP | +-------+-------+ | +-------+-------+ | 机械按键矩阵 | +-------+-------+ | +-------+-------+ | 3.5mm耳机孔 | +---------------+

四个机械按键分别实现:

  • 左键:频率递减(步进0.1MHz)
  • 右键:频率递增
  • 上键:音量+
  • 下键:音量-

实用技巧:在按键触点并联0.1μF电容可消除机械抖动

4. 复古美学的外壳改造

捡来的檀木茶叶罐成为完美外壳:

  1. 用雕刻刀开出按键孔位
  2. 内部贴铜箔屏蔽电磁干扰
  3. 保留原罐盖作调谐旋钮装饰

最耗时的反而是做旧处理:

  • 砂纸打磨边缘制造使用痕迹
  • 咖啡渍渗透木纹
  • 用烙铁烫出"维修标记"

最终成品放在书桌上时,常有朋友误以为是古董市场淘来的老物件。当按下机械按键瞬间,"咔嗒"声伴随着FM电台的电流杂音,这种混合了数字与模拟时代的体验,或许就是硬件DIY最迷人的地方。

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/30 21:06:28

三步搞定小说离线阅读:novel-downloader开源工具终极指南

三步搞定小说离线阅读:novel-downloader开源工具终极指南 【免费下载链接】novel-downloader 一个可扩展的通用型小说下载器。 项目地址: https://gitcode.com/gh_mirrors/no/novel-downloader 你是否曾遇到过心爱的小说突然从网站上消失?或者因为…

作者头像 李华
网站建设 2026/4/30 21:00:21

LLaMA系列:开源大模型标杆详解

LLaMA系列:开源大模型标杆详解📝 本章学习目标:通过本章学习,你将全面掌握"LLaMA系列:开源大模型标杆详解"这一核心主题,建立系统性认知。一、引言:为什么这个话题如此重要 在人工智能…

作者头像 李华
网站建设 2026/4/30 21:00:16

论next/js在打击省份及犯罪行为集团的系统分析[特殊字符]设计

### 问题解构核心诉求在于**Next.js 项目初始化后的配置优化策略**,特别是如何构建一个“最全面”的企业级 next.config.js 配置文件。这不仅仅是简单的参数设置,而是涉及架构演进(App Router vs Pages Router)、性能极致优化&…

作者头像 李华
网站建设 2026/4/30 20:55:42

ESP32开发板在汽车CAN总线应用中的实践与优化

1. RejsaCAN-ESP32开发板概述 RejsaCAN-ESP32是一款专为汽车应用设计的紧凑型开发板,基于ESP32-WROOM-32模块构建。这块板子的独特之处在于它完美适配3D打印的OBD-II接口外壳,可以直接插入大多数车辆的诊断接口使用。作为一名长期从事汽车电子开发的工程…

作者头像 李华